1.如何限制远程登陆时,不允许root登陆,而只允许普通用户登陆?
答案:
修改配置文件/etc/sshd/sshd_config, 在文件中查找 "#PermitRootLogin yes" 这句话, 修改为
"PermitRootLogin no”表示不允许root用户远程登录。 /etc/sshd/sshd_config
为sshd服务的配置文件,默认虽然在前面加"#"注释了这句,"PermitRootLogin yes”
但它默认就是允许root账户登陆的,所以要想不让root登陆,修改为no 就可以了。保存配置文件后,重启sshd 服务: service
sshd restart
2. 如何限制远程登陆时,只允许root使用密钥登陆,而不能使用密码登陆?
答案:
打开配置文件 /etc/sshd/sshd_config 加上一句:
PermitRootLogin without-password
保存配置文件后,重启sshd 服务: service sshd restart
远程登录
原创
©著作权归作者所有:来自51CTO博客作者战狼战神的原创作品,请联系作者获取转载授权,否则将追究法律责任
上一篇:find搜索命令
下一篇:linux系统时间更新
提问和评论都可以,用心的回复会被更多人看到
评论
发布评论
相关文章
-
远程登录
我远程连接到我的同学的本本上面输入用户名和密码,但是总是提醒密码错误。还有一个问题就是这个用户名就是电脑的名字吗?
职场 WINDOWS 休闲 远程登录